Appeals Court Reinstates Trump Tariffs Temporarily

A US appeals court temporarily reinstated President Trump's tariffs, halting a lower court's decision that blocked them due to the administration's use of the IEEPA emergency law. The tariffs, including a 10 percent base tariff and additional levies on imports from China, Canada, and Mexico, remain ...

France Legalizes Aid in Dying, Joining Four Other EU Nations

France's National Assembly passed a law legalizing aid in dying, joining four other EU countries with similar legislation; in 2023, these countries reported 13,715 euthanasia cases.

Controversial Military Parade Planned for Trump's Birthday

A $25-$45 million military parade in Washington D.C. on June 14th, 2025, celebrating the U.S. Army's 250th anniversary and President Trump's 79th birthday, has sparked controversy due to its cost, potential infrastructure damage, and perceived authoritarian symbolism.

Toyota to Produce GR Corolla in UK

Toyota is shifting production of its GR Corolla hot hatchback from Japan to its Burnaston, UK plant in 2026 to meet high US demand and leverage the US-UK trade deal, marking the first time a GR-branded vehicle will be made outside Japan.

Russian Warship Spied on UK Missile Defence Exercise

The Royal Navy intercepted a Russian research vessel, Yuri Ivanov, spying on a UK missile defense exercise, Formidable Shield, off the Outer Hebrides on May 18, prompting a response from HMS Dragon and the monitoring of another Russian warship in the English Channel by HMS Ledbury and HMS Hurworth.
